/// Attempt to read a certain amount of data from a stream before returning.
|
||||
/**
|
||||
* This function is used to read a certain number of bytes of data from a
|
||||
* stream. The call will block until one of the following conditions is true:
|
||||
*
|
||||
* @li The supplied buffers are full. That is, the bytes transferred is equal to
|
||||
* the sum of the buffer sizes.
|
||||
*
|
||||
* @li An error occurred.
|
||||
*
|
||||
* This operation is implemented in terms of zero or more calls to the stream's
|
||||
* read_some function.
|
||||
*
|
||||
* @param s The stream from which the data is to be read. The type must support
|
||||
* the SyncReadStream concept.
|
||||
*
|
||||
* @param buffers One or more buffers into which the data will be read. The sum
|
||||
* of the buffer sizes indicates the maximum number of bytes to read from the
|
||||
* stream.
|
||||
*
|
||||
* @param ec Set to indicate what error occurred, if any.
|
||||
*
|
||||
* @returns The number of bytes transferred.
|
||||
*
|
||||
* @par Example
|
||||
* To read into a single data buffer use the @ref buffer function as follows:
|
||||
* @code boost::asio::read(s, boost::asio::buffer(data, size), ec); @endcode
|
||||
* See the @ref buffer documentation for information on reading into multiple
|
||||
* buffers in one go, and how to use it with arrays, boost::array or
|
||||
* std::vector.
|
||||
*
|
||||
* @note This overload is equivalent to calling:
|
||||
* @code boost::asio::read(
|
||||
* s, buffers,
|
||||
* boost::asio::transfer_all(), ec); @endcode
|
||||
*/
|
||||
template <typename SyncReadStream, typename MutableBufferSequence>
|
||||
std::size_t read(SyncReadStream& s, const MutableBufferSequence& buffers,
|
||||
boost::system::error_code& ec);
